October in Tian'an, China, showcases a vibrant transition from summer to autumn, with maximum temperatures peaking at 32°C (91°F) and a comfortable average of 24°C (76°F). The month experiences a notable shift in weather patterns, characterized by high humidity levels of 80% and frequent rainfall, accumulating to 203 mm (8.0 in) over 18 rainy days. In October, Tian'an, China experiences a notable shift in precipitation patterns, receiving 203 mm (8.0 in) of rain over 18 days. Following the intense summer months, where rainfall peaked at 365 mm in August, October marks a decrease in precipitation but remains one of the wetter months of the year. This drop from the heavier rains of September, which recorded 214 mm, suggests a transition towards drier winter conditions. In October, Tian'an experiences a notable shift as humidity levels settle at 80%, marking a slight decrease from the peak summer months of July and August, which both recorded a high 87%. This mild dip reflects a transitional phase in the climate, as the humidity gradually lessens from the summer's sweltering grip. The persistence of higher humidity throughout September, at 82%, indicates a lingering warmth, but as October unfolds, the air begins to feel more breathable. Overall, the month stands out as a bridge, balancing the summer's moisture against the impending crispness of autumn, while remaining consistently above the winter months, which see humidity levels drop to the low to mid-70s.

October and January present a striking contrast in weather conditions. October boasts warm temperatures ranging from a minimum of 17°C (63°F) to a maximum of 32°C (91°F), with an average of 24°C (76°F), accompanied by significant rainfall of 203 mm (8.0 in) over 18 days and high humidity at 80%. In comparison, January offers cooler temperatures, with a minimum of 7°C (44°F), an average of 19°C (66°F), and a maximum of 28°C (83°F).
